The grid has 5 reels and 7 rows. It uses a Cluster Pays mechanism. Five or more matching symbols connect. They must connect horizontally or vertically. This forms a winning cluster. Traditional paylines are absent here. This structure is key to how to play Contact.

Winning clusters cascade uniquely here. Unlike typical tumbles, winning symbols stay. Non-winning symbols are removed. New symbols fall into place. This allows clusters to grow. New clusters can form simultaneously. This happens within a single spin. This persistent cascade is innovative. It impacts how to play Contact.
